Step-by-Step Instructions for Caramelized Banana Iced Latte
- In a skillet, melt 2 tablespoons of unsalted butter over medium heat. Once melted, add 2 sliced ripe bananas, 2 tablespoons of brown sugar, 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ract, a pinch of ground cinnamon, and a pinch of salt. Cook for about 3-5 minutes, stirring gently until the bananas turn golden brown and caramelized.
- While the bananas are caramelizing, brew a strong cup of coffee or espresso using about 1 cup of water and 2 tablespoons of coffee grounds for a rich flavor.
- Fill a tall glass with ice cubes to chill your drink. Pour in the cooled brewed coffee, filling the glass about halfway. Add 1 cup of your choice of milk and stir gently.
- Spoon the caramelized bananas over the iced latte and drizzle 1-2 tablespoons of caramel sauce on top.
- Optionally, top your latte with a swirl of whipped cream, finish off with another drizzle of caramel sauce and a sliced banana for garnish.
